‘My Goodness, Did He Love the Oregon Ducks’: Charlie Kirk Remembered as Passionate UO Football Fan

EUGENE, Ore. — Conservative activist Charlie Kirk, who was shot and killed Sept. 10 during a college event in Utah, is being remembered not only for his political career but also for his deep passion for Oregon Ducks football.

A Lifelong Sports Enthusiast

Kirk, 31, grew up in Illinois, where he became a loyal fan of the Chicago Cubs. But it was Oregon football that captured his heart later in life. According to his wife, Erika Kirk, the Ducks became one of his greatest sporting obsessions.

“My goodness, did he love the Oregon Ducks,” Erika said in a Sept. 12 statement to the nation. “He’d want me to say ‘Go Ducks,’ so I have to since they play on Saturday. So go Ducks.”

Building Life Around Ducks Football

Kirk’s enthusiasm wasn’t casual. Friends said he often scheduled events around Ducks game times, making sure he didn’t miss a kickoff.

Clay Travis, founder of Outkick, noted that Kirk attended Oregon’s dramatic 32–31 victory over Ohio State at Autzen Stadium in 2024, an experience he frequently described as one of his favorite sports memories.

On social media, Kirk often posted about the team, celebrating their wins and lamenting their losses with the fervor of a lifelong fan.

A Surprising Connection

Though Kirk never attended the University of Oregon, his attachment to the program ran deep. The reasons for his connection to the Ducks remain personal, but friends said he admired the team’s energy, competitiveness, and culture.

For many who followed his work, his love of Oregon football offered a glimpse of the man behind the public persona — a reminder that even amid heated political debates, he found joy in college sports.

Remembered by Fans and Family

As news of his death spread, many Ducks fans reflected on Kirk’s unlikely but passionate bond with their team. While his politics sparked controversy, his enthusiasm for Oregon football was genuine and widely acknowledged.

His wife’s heartfelt message underscored how central the Ducks were to his life. “He’d want me to cheer them on, and I know he’ll be watching in spirit,” Erika said.

A Passion That Endured

For Kirk, sports were more than a pastime — they were a way of connecting with others and celebrating moments of joy. His love for the Oregon Ducks remains one of the more personal parts of his legacy, remembered by those who knew him best.

As the Ducks prepare to take the field this weekend, fans across the country — including some who never expected to share common ground with Kirk — may find themselves echoing his familiar refrain: “Go Ducks.”
